Centre cuts excise duty on petrol by Rs 8 per litre and diesel by Rs 6 per litre

Further, the Centre will give a subsidy of Rs 200 per LPG cylinder (upto 12 cylinders) to over 9 crore beneficiaries of the Pradhan Mantri Ujjwala Yojana.

The Union government on Saturday decided to reduce the central excise duty on petrol by Rs 8 per litre and on diesel by Rs 6 per litre, which will reduce the price of petrol by Rs 9.5 per litre and that of diesel by Rs 7 per litre.
Announcing the decision in a series of tweets, Union Finance Minister Nirmala Sitharaman said the decision was taken as the government is "devoted to the welfare of the poor" and the "middle class". The reduction will have a revenue implication of Rs 1 lakh crore per year, Sitharaman said.

Sitharaman also urged state governments to take similar steps and reduce fuel prices.
